What Causes AC Failures

What Causes AC Systems to Fail in Fort Calhoun, NE

Refrigerant Leaks and Low Charge in Fort Calhoun

Refrigerant does not deplete under normal operation in Fort Calhoun, NE. Low refrigerant indicates a leak in the refrigerant circuit in Fort Calhoun. The leak must be found and repaired before refrigerant is added, or the added refrigerant leaks out and the problem recurs in Fort Calhoun, NE.

Dirty or Blocked Condenser Coils in Fort Calhoun, NE

A condenser coil coated in dirt and debris reduces its ability to reject heat in Fort Calhoun. The system runs at elevated head pressure, reducing efficiency and increasing compressor wear in Fort Calhoun, NE. MBM cleans condenser coils using appropriate products that restore performance without damaging the coil fins in Fort Calhoun.

Failed Capacitors and Contactors in Fort Calhoun

Capacitors provide the electrical boost that starts the compressor and condenser fan motor in Fort Calhoun, NE. A failing or failed capacitor causes the compressor or fan to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Fort Calhoun. Capacitor failure is one of the most common AC repair situations in Fort Calhoun, NE.

Compressor Failure in Fort Calhoun, NE

The compressor is the most expensive single component in the AC system in Fort Calhoun. Compressor failure typically results from long-term operation under abnormal conditions including low refrigerant, dirty condenser coils, or failed capacitors in Fort Calhoun, NE. A failed compressor requires replacement in Fort Calhoun.

Electrical and Control Board Faults in Fort Calhoun

Modern AC systems rely on electronic control boards that manage compressor staging, fan operation, and safety shutdowns in Fort Calhoun, NE.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Fort Calhoun.

The most common causes in Fort Calhoun are low refrigerant from a leak reducing cooling capacity, a dirty condenser coil reducing heat rejection efficiency, and a failed condenser fan motor allowing the condenser to overheat in Fort Calhoun, NE. A compressor that is operating but not pumping refrigerant efficiently is a less common but more significant cause in Fort Calhoun.
A frozen evaporator coil indicates either restricted airflow preventing adequate heat exchange at the coil or low refrigerant causing the coil temperature to drop below freezing in Fort Calhoun. Turn the system to fan-only mode to allow the ice to melt before calling for service in Fort Calhoun, NE. Do not try to chip or break the ice off the coil in Fort Calhoun.
Short cycling has several possible causes in Fort Calhoun including a failing capacitor, a refrigerant charge that is incorrect causing safety switch trips, a frozen evaporator coil triggering freeze protection shutdown, and an oversized system that satisfies the thermostat before completing a full cooling cycle in Fort Calhoun, NE.
Indicators of low refrigerant in Fort Calhoun include the system running continuously without reaching setpoint, warm air from supply registers, ice on the refrigerant lines near the air handler, and hissing sounds from the refrigerant circuit in Fort Calhoun, NE. Refrigerant level can only be reliably assessed with pressure gauges connected to the refrigerant circuit in Fort Calhoun.
A capacitor provides the high-voltage boost needed to start the compressor and condenser fan motors in Fort Calhoun. A failing capacitor causes the motors to struggle to start, producing a humming sound and excessive heat in the motor in Fort Calhoun, NE. A failed capacitor causes the motor to fail to start entirely in Fort Calhoun.
Water dripping from the indoor air handler typically indicates a clogged condensate drain line in Fort Calhoun. The condensate pan overflows when the drain cannot remove the water the evaporator coil is extracting from the air in Fort Calhoun, NE. A cracked or damaged condensate pan is a less common cause in Fort Calhoun.
Most common AC repairs including capacitor replacement, contactor replacement, and condensate drain clearing take one to two hours in Fort Calhoun. More complex repairs including refrigerant leak location and repair, control board replacement, and evaporator coil replacement take two to four hours or more in Fort Calhoun, NE.
It depends on the specific noise in Fort Calhoun. A mild rattling or vibration may be safe to operate temporarily while repair is arranged in Fort Calhoun, NE. A grinding, banging, or clanking sound from the compressor indicates an internal mechanical fault that can cause rapid compressor failure if continued in Fort Calhoun. A hissing sound indicating a refrigerant leak should prompt stopping the system and calling for service in Fort Calhoun, NE.
There is no absolute age cutoff in Fort Calhoun. The decision depends on the repair cost, the system's age, and its overall condition in Fort Calhoun, NE. If the repair cost exceeds 50 percent of the cost of a comparable new system and the existing system is more than 10 to 12 years old, replacement warrants serious consideration in Fort Calhoun.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the evaporator coil below the minimum needed for correct operation in Fort Calhoun. The coil drops below freezing and ice builds on the coil surface in Fort Calhoun, NE. The ice buildup progressively blocks all airflow and eventually causes the system to shut down completely in Fort Calhoun.
